Calculate Log Base 69 of 154

To solve the equation log 69 (154)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 154, a = 69:
    log 69 (154) = log(154) / log(69)
  3. Evaluate the term:
    log(154) / log(69)
    = 1.39794000867204 / 1.92427928606188
    = 1.1896140536249
